Your new company
With a solid history and a growing record of success, this organisation is a major player in the energy and utility sector. Due to a busy workload following a recent acquisition and further growth, a vacancy has arisen in the Manchester office for an in-house lawyer to lead on data protection and GDPR matters. There is also an option to based in Lancashire, outside of the city centre, should that be preference.

Your new role
You will join a high calibre legal department and will work autonomously in a newly created role to review data protection compliance across the business and introduce best practices in line with GDPR. You must be able to provide expert advice in areas of responsibility by being fully conversant with all relevant legislation. Ideally you will have had previous experience in leading and implementing GDPR projects.

What you'll need to succeed
You must have a proven track record in providing strategic, high quality, timely and risk based advice on data protection matters and you will be able to manage in-house legal queries as well as lead on GDPR projects. This could be an ideal opportunity for a high quality lawyer looking to move in-house in a GDPR focused role or an in-house lawyer with solid data protection experience, looking to take on the responsibility of DPO. You will have trained with a top tier firm and have exc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to build relationships at all levels of the business.
